Moab, Utah \u2013 The Whole Enchilada<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>If you\u2019ve ever pedaled Moab, you already know: it\u2019s iconic for a reason. The Whole Enchilada descends over 7,000 vertical feet from the alpine peaks of the La Sal Mountains into the red rock desert floor. Expect everything &#8211; forests, ledges, loose rock, slickrock, and scenery that could stop you in your tracks (if the terrain doesn\u2019t first).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Why it&#8217;s worth shipping your bike: This isn\u2019t a ride you want to tackle on a rental. The variety of terrain means comfort and familiarity with your own setup are key.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2. Whistler, British Columbia \u2013 Whistler Mountain Bike Park<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Home to Crankworx and the holy grail of lift-accessed downhill, Whistler\u2019s bike park is where legends are made. With over 80 expertly crafted trails ranging from gentle flow to full-send double blacks, it\u2019s a pilgrimage spot for riders around the world.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Insider tip: Bring your full-face helmet and body armor, and your own bike. You\u2019ll want every advantage you can get when dropping into A-Line.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3. Brevard, North Carolina \u2013 Pisgah National Forest<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Pisgah is raw, rooted, and relentlessly fun. Riders flock to trails like Black Mountain, Bennett Gap, and Avery Creek for backcountry-style riding with serious elevation, punchy climbs, and fast, technical descents.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Why it&#8217;s special: It\u2019s one of the few places in the East that feels truly big. Expect loamy dirt, mossy trees, and rides that test your grit.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">4. Crested Butte, Colorado \u2013 401 Trail<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>This high-country loop is an alpine dream. Climbing to over 11,000 feet, the 401 Trail delivers vast views of wildflower meadows, towering peaks, and ribbons of singletrack snaking down the mountainside.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Don\u2019t forget: The altitude is no joke.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shipskis.com\/\">Ship your bike ahead<\/a>, fly in light, and give yourself a day to acclimate before tackling the climbs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">5. Kingdom Trails, Vermont \u2013 East Burke<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Flowy, fast, and ridiculously fun, the Kingdom Trails system offers over 100 miles of well-maintained trails through lush Northeast forest. Trails like Tap &#8216;n Die and Sidewinder keep your wheels turning and your smile wide.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>What makes it unique: It\u2019s one of the most accessible and family-friendly trail networks out there, with terrain for every level of rider.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">6. Bend, Oregon \u2013 Phil\u2019s Trail System<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Phil\u2019s is where fun meets finesse. With smooth climbs, fast descents, and views of the Cascade Mountains, it\u2019s ideal for intermediate riders looking to progress, or for experts who want a fast-paced cruise.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Bonus: Bend\u2019s beer scene is just as legendary as its singletrack. Ride hard, then rehydrate locally.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">7. Sedona, Arizona \u2013 Highline &amp; Hangover<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>With its surreal red rock landscape and slickrock playgrounds, Sedona is home to some of the best mountain biking trails in the States. Trails like Highline and Hangover offer heart-pounding exposure and jaw-dropping desert views.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Pro tip: Sedona\u2019s terrain is unforgiving. Bring your own bike to feel confident on those exposed lines.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">8. Lake Tahoe, California\/Nevada \u2013 Mr. Toad\u2019s Wild Ride<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>This isn\u2019t just a trail &#8211; it\u2019s a rite of passage. With steep granite chutes, tight switchbacks, and Tahoe\u2019s alpine beauty all around, Mr. Toad\u2019s Wild Ride is a bucket-lister for advanced riders.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Good to know: The climb to the top is no joke. Ship your full-suspension rig and prepare for a rowdy descent.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">9. Park City, Utah \u2013 Mid Mountain Trail<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>A designated IMBA Gold-Level Ride Center, Park City\u2019s Mid Mountain Trail winds through aspen groves and meadows at 8,000 feet, offering a mix of fast flow and mellow climbs across 20+ miles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Bonus: The trail connects with dozens of others, letting you create a full-day epic without ever repeating a section.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">10. Copper Harbor, Michigan \u2013 Flow Trail<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Tucked on the Upper Peninsula, Copper Harbor offers rugged riding with Great Lakes views. Its Flow Trail is a favorite &#8211; machine-built with berms, jumps, and rollers that feel more like a rollercoaster than a bike trail.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Why it belongs: It proves you don\u2019t need elevation to have world-class riding.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">11. Mont-Sainte-Anne, Quebec \u2013 La Bouttaboutte &amp; La Grisante<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Just outside Qu\u00e9bec City, Mont-Sainte-Anne is a four-season resort that\u2019s just as famous for its best mountain biking trails as its ski slopes. From technical rock gardens to smooth berms, it\u2019s a top destination for enduro and downhill riders alike.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Why go: It\u2019s hosted multiple UCI World Cups and offers a European-style riding vibe with French-Canadian flair.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">12. Canmore &amp; Banff, Alberta \u2013 Highline Trail &amp; Reclaimer<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>For a more backcountry experience, the Canmore\/Banff area offers rugged singletrack through jaw-dropping landscapes. Highline is a locals\u2019 favorite with challenging climbs, fast descents, and postcard-worthy views.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Pro tip: Bring bear spray &#8211; and your own bike.
